JAMB Reschedules 2025 UTME Registration to February 3

Joint Admissions and Matriculation Board (JAMB) said the registration for the 2025 Unified Tertiary Matriculation Examination (UTME) will now commence on Monday, February 3, 2025, instead of Friday, January 31, 2025, as earlier slated. The Board’s Public Communication Advisor, Dr Fabian Benjamin, disclosed this in a statement on Friday, Jan. 31. He said the change was necessary…
